$ grep -i error /var/log/armbian-hardware-monitor.log 
[    2.990779] rockchip-pcie f8000000.pcie: probe with driver rockchip-pcie failed with error -110


Looking at this I see the following: 

https://patchwork.ozlabs.org/project/linux-pci/patch/20210421083115.30213-1-jinsiyu940203@163.com/

 

"In function rockchip_pcie_host_init_port(), it defines a timeout value of 500ms to wait for pcie training. However, it is not enough for samsung PM953 SSD drive and realtek RTL8111F network adapter, which leads to the following errors:

 

[ 0.879663] rockchip-pcie f8000000.pcie: PCIe link training gen1 timeout!

[ 0.880284] rockchip-pcie f8000000.pcie: deferred probe failed

[ 0.880932] rockchip-pcie: probe of f8000000.pcie failed with error -110

 

The pcie spec only defines the min time of training, not the max one. So set a proper timeout value is important. Change the value to 1000ms will fix this bug."

 

Is it possible for team to add patch such as ../patch/kernel/rockchip64-current/0002-rockchip-pcie-increase-timeout.patch which contains the fix specified in the patchwork.ozlabs.org link above?
